Treatment Options for Osteoarthritis
The orthopedic team provides different surgical solutions. The choice depends on the patient's specific condition.
- Arthroscopy: This minimally invasive surgery uses a small camera. It repairs or cleans the joint. Hospital stay is typically 1-2 days.
- Total Hip Arthroplasty: This surgery replaces the damaged hip with an implant. A cementless technique is often used. The package includes a 5-night hospital stay and pre-op tests.
- Knee Replacement: This procedure restores function to a severely damaged knee. Both robotic-assisted and conventional techniques are available. Hospitalization lasts 4-5 days.
